2.1.

Warlock Talent Tree Highlights

Some important spells to note in the Warlock talent tree:

  • Mortal Coil Icon Mortal Coil gives you extra control over the enemy team with instant crowd control. This ability will also heal you, which is great for increasing your survivability.
  • Demon Skin Icon Demon Skin/Fel Armor Icon Fel Armor are both really strong talents that help increase your survivability.
  • Soulburn Icon Soulburn allows you to empower many of your spells. Some to note is that it will increase the healing of Healthstone Icon Healthstone and your max health. Also, after you use Demonic Circle: Teleport Icon Demonic Circle: Teleport, your movement speed will be increased and you are immune to roots/snares for 8 sec.
2.2.

Demonology Warlock Talent Tree Highlights

Some important spells to note in the Demonology Warlock Talent tree:

  • Power Siphon Icon Power Siphon gives you more on-demand damage by sacrificing two of your imps. This results in two charges of Demonic Core Icon Demonic Core, giving you instant Demonbolt Icon Demonbolts.
  • From the Shadows Icon From the Shadows causes Dreadbite Icon Dreadbite deal additional damage to your target. This increases the damage dealt by some of your important spells, such as Hand of Gul'dan Icon Hand of Gul'dan and Summon Demonic Tyrant Icon Summon Demonic Tyrant. This also works well with the Dreadlash Icon Dreadlash talent.
  • Guillotine Icon Guillotine is one of the final talents you can take and this causes your Felguard to deal AoE damage near your target. This is a great talent for increasing damage, but be careful because this will break crowd control.
3.

PvP Talents for Demonology Warlocks

You can choose 3 of the following PvP talents. Each of them has their uses, but some are better for certain strategies than others. The top three choices are the most useful, but can be replaced with other PvP talents, depending on your team's goal.

3.1.

Mandatory PvP Talents

Call Felhunter Icon Call Felhunter gives you an interrupt that locks an enemy in that school for 6 seconds. This PvP talent is crucial to stop incoming crowd control or, more importantly, to interrupt a healer that is casting a powerful spell.

Master Summoner Icon Master Summoner makes your Call Dreadstalkers Icon Call Dreadstalkers instant. This is crucial to increase your sustained damage and gives your more time to cast more important spells.

3.2.

Situational PvP Talents

Fel Obelisk Icon Fel Obelisk empowers you and your minions, increasing attack speed and reducing the cast time of spells. This is great for when you are playing a team composition where the enemy team will struggle to kill the Obelisk.

Call Fel Lord Icon Call Fel Lord summons a Fel Lord at a location that will stun anyone that enters its ring. This ability is crucial against melee who try to ignore it. This also increases your survivability if you stand by your Fel Lord. You should replace Nether Ward Icon Nether Ward for this PvP talent.

Nether Ward Icon Nether Ward surrounds the caster with a shield that last 3 sec, reflecting all harmful spells cast on you. This is a crucial talent to take against all casters. You also want to use this talent versus teams with a Shaman, Death Knight or Demon Hunter. This is because their kicks are magical and this will prevent you from being interrupted while it is active.
